chemical mediators in innate and adaptive immunity Flashcards
(43 cards)
IL-1
Inflammation, endothelial cell activation, fever, IL6 production
IL2
Proliferation & differentiation of T cells
IL3
Maturation of hematopoietic lineages, macrophage differentiation
IL4
TH2 differentiation, B cell proliferation & differentiation, IgG1, IgE isotypes
IL5
Plasma cell differentiation, IgA isotype, eosinophil activation
IL6
Fever, acute phase response, plasma cell differentiation, Th17 differentiation
IL7
B & T cell development, Memory T cells
IL10
B-1 proliferation, inhibits macrophages
IL12
NK cell activation, TH1 differentiation
IL13
B cell differentiation, IgE isotype, macrophage alternate activation
IL15
Proliferation of memory CD8+ T cells and NK cells
IL17
Increased cytokine and chemokine production by macrophages and endothelial cells
TNFα
Inflammation, endothelial cell activation, fever, FDC differentiation, cachexia
TGFβ
Treg & Th17 differentiation, B cell differentiation, IgG2b, IgA, inhibits macrophages
IFNγ
Macrophage activation, TH1 differentiation, B cell differentiation, IgG2a, IgG3 isotypes
IFNα
Inhibits viral replication, increases MHC Class I expression, activates NK cells
IFNβ
Inhibits viral replication, activates NK cells
GCSF/MCSF/GMCSF
Granulocyte/monocyte differentiation, stem cell recruitment
Histamine
Vasodilation/vascular permeability, endothelial cell activation
Prostacyclin
Vasodilation
Thromboxane
Vasoconstriction
Prostaglandin E2 (PGE2)
Pain, central nervous system mediator of fever
Leukotrienes
Vascular permeability, bronchoconstriction
Lymphotoxin (LT)
FDC differentiation
